Grover Robert Martin

JACKSONVILLE — Grover Robert Martin, 79, of Jacksonville, TX was called home by his Lord and Savior on a full moon night, May 6th, 2012. He was born on March 15, 1933 in Ennis, TX to Homer G. and Ruth Martin.

Grover grew up in Ennis, TX. He graduated from Ennis High School in 1950. Joined the Navy in 1951—served 4 years as an Airman 1st Class on several carriers, including The Randolph. He went to work for Shell Chemical in 1955 in Pasadena, TX. He met and married Theta Sessions in 1956; must have been love at first sight. During his life, Grover was a deacon, a mason, a truck driver, a salesman; but always a dedicated family man. He had a heart of gold and was slow to anger. His patience with his family knew no limits.

Grover is survived by his loving wife of 56 years; Theta P. Sessions Martin, of Jacksonville, TX  He is also survived by his daughter-Lee Ann West; son- Homer and wife Vicki; granddaughter-Mandi Medrano and husband Chris; grandson-Zachary Martin West; sister-Pat Holcomb and 2 new great grandbabies on the way.

He will be loved, remembered with laughter, and dearly missed by everyone.  We have faith; that all those who have preceded him to the Kingdom of Heaven, will be there with open hearts.
